How Long Do Braces Take in New York, NY

Are you curious about how long do braces take in New York, NY? Typically, braces take around 18 to 24 months, but the timeline depends on factors like the severity of your misalignment, age, and compliance with treatment instructions. Some patients may complete their treatment sooner, while others may require additional time to address more complex dental concerns. Factors Influencing Braces Duration

Several key factors determine how long you’ll need braces. Here are the most important ones to consider:

1. Severity of Misalignment

  • Mild Misalignment: Cases involving slight crowding or spacing can often be resolved in 12 to 18 months, especially with Invisalign or other clear aligners.
  • Moderate to Severe Misalignment: Overbites, underbites, crossbites, and severe crowding typically take 18-24 months or longer.

The more complex the alignment issue, the more adjustments are needed to achieve a healthy and functional bite.

2. Age of the Patient

Orthodontic treatment works at any age, but Dr. Andre Correia Jham, an experienced orthodontist in Bloomingdale and Naperville, IL, notes that younger patients typically see faster results because their teeth and jawbones are still developing, making adjustments more efficient. This is because a child’s teeth and jaw are still developing, making it easier to adjust their alignment.

For adults, treatment may take slightly longer since their jawbones have stopped growing. Nevertheless, Gramercy Orthodontics offers advanced solutions for treating both children and adults effectively.

3. Type of Braces

The type of braces you choose plays a significant role in determining the timeline:

  • Metal Braces: Highly effective for complex cases, metal braces usually take 18-24 months.
  • Ceramic Braces: These offer a more discreet option, but the treatment duration is typically the same as metal braces: 18-24 months.
  • Invisalign: For mild to moderate cases, Invisalign clear aligners can take 12-18 months to achieve results.

4. Compliance with Instructions

A smooth treatment process relies on closely following your orthodontist’s advice. Skipping appointments, not wearing rubber bands, or failing to clean aligners properly can delay progress. Compliance is critical to staying on schedule.

5. Individual Tooth Movement

Every smile is unique, and teeth move at different speeds. Your orthodontist will monitor your progress closely and make necessary adjustments to keep everything on track.

Typical Braces Treatment Timeline

The timeline for braces varies depending on your specific case and treatment plan. Here’s a general guide:

  • Mild Cases: Around 12-18 months with aligners or traditional braces.
  • Moderate Cases: Most treatments take 18-24 months, with regular checkups to monitor progress.
  • Severe Cases: In complex cases, treatment may take up to 30 months or longer, especially if jaw realignment is involved.

Braces Treatment Process

Wondering what to expect during your braces journey? Here are the major steps involved in the process:

1. Initial Consultation

Your orthodontist will examine your teeth and jaws, take X-rays or 3D scans, and discuss your goals. This is also when you can explore different treatment options, such as metal braces, ceramic braces, or Invisalign.

2. Creating a Personalized Plan

Once your orthodontist assesses your alignment, they’ll create a step-by-step treatment plan tailored to your specific needs. This plan will outline expected timelines, costs, and milestones.

3. Regular Adjustments

Throughout your treatment, you’ll visit Gramercy Orthodontics every 4-8 weeks to adjust your braces or monitor your progress with aligners. These checkups ensure your teeth are moving according to the plan and allow for any necessary tweaks.

4. Final Stage: Retainers and Maintenance

When your braces are removed, your orthodontist will provide retainers to maintain your new alignment. Retainers are crucial for long-term success, preventing your teeth from shifting back to their original positions.

Types of Braces: Pros, Cons, and Duration

Here’s a closer look at the different types of braces available and their typical timelines:

Traditional Metal Braces

  • Durability: Reliable for complex alignment issues.
  • Timeline: Usually 18 to 24 months, with regular tightening appointments.

Ceramic Braces

  • Aesthetic Appeal: Tooth-colored brackets make them less noticeable than metal braces.
  • Timeline: Similar to metal braces, typically 18 to 24 months, but they require extra care to avoid damage.

Invisalign Clear Aligners

  • Discreet and Removable: Ideal for mild to moderate cases.
  • Timeline: Treatment can last 12 to 18 months, but patients must wear their aligners for at least 22 hours a day to stay on track.

Maintaining Oral Hygiene During Braces

Good oral hygiene is essential during orthodontic treatment. It prevents delays caused by cavities or gum disease and keeps your smile healthy throughout the process.

Tips for Maintaining Hygiene

  • Brush Regularly: Use a soft toothbrush to clean around wires and brackets.
  • Floss Daily: Consider a water flosser or pre-threaded floss for easier use.
  • Clean Aligners: Rinse your aligners daily to prevent plaque buildup, and soak them in a cleaning solution as directed.

Life After Braces: Retainers and Long-Term Success

Once your braces come off, the journey isn’t quite over. Retainers play a vital role in maintaining your results:

  • Full-Time Wear: Wear your retainer day and night for the first few months after braces.
  • Nighttime Maintenance: After the initial period, nighttime wear helps ensure long-term retention.

Scheduling regular follow-ups ensures your smile stays aligned for years to come.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can braces be done in 3 months?

Traditional braces treatments take about 18 to 24 months. However, there are some accelerated options available, like Invisalign Express or other fast-track treatments, which might help achieve results in a shorter period, sometimes around 3 to 6 months.

What is the shortest time for braces?

When it comes to wearing braces, the shortest time can vary depending on individual needs, but typically, some people might see results in as little as six months. This is often the case with minor adjustments or when using accelerated orthodontic treatments.
